You Can Recover All

Read 1 Samuel 30:1ff
Memorize: And David inquired of the Lord, "Shall I pursue this raiding party? Will I overtake them?" "Pursue them," he answered. "You will certainly overtake them and succeed in the rescue" (1 Samuel 30:4). Before David's return from battle, his camp had been raided by enemies who took away everything. What a sudden and very painful loss! He became very sad, and wept sore. To worsen matters, his people resorted to castigating and threatening him. What a terrible situation! Does this describe your situation? Check out what he did. Thank God for His Spirit that triggered David to a new perspective to what happened. Suddenly, he realized that: Weeping will not save me Though my face were bathed in tears That could not allay my fears Could not wash the sins of years Weeping will not save me. Then he enquired from the LORD, who gave him the go ahead, went with him and his warriors as they pursued, overtook and recovered all that had earlier been taken away. God's strength is available for you today, He will go ahead of you, and you will recover all. Just stop weeping, pray, trust Him, and confront your challenges. God will grant you recovery, restoration and rehabilitation in Jesus' name, but be sure you are listening and obeying Him.
